FIGURE 4. In an ECG Amplifier, an Isolation Amplifier Protects the Circuitry and the Patient from Leakage Current from 60Hz Line Operated Equipment and From High-Voltage Transients Caused By Other Equipment. An important consideration is the ECG amplifier’s com- mon-mode input impedance.

What is ECG amplifier?

An electrocardiogram (ECG) amplifier is an electronic component that converts relatively weak electrical signals from the heart to signals that can be output to a monitoring system. Electrodes on the body are typically where the signals are picked up first. Operational amplifiers are often used in such machines.

What is the purpose of using isolation amplifier?

An isolation amplifier is fundamentally used to reduce the common voltage between the source side and the power load side. They provide electrical isolation and acts as electrical safety barriers. They are also used to protect the operators from leakage currents. These are some of the most frequently used devices.

How is ECG signal generated?

Electrical signals are produced by contractions in the heart walls which drive electrical currents and create different potentials throughout the body. By placing electrodes on the skin, one can detect and record this electrical activity in an ECG.

Which is used as an isolation amplifier or a buffer?

A voltage follower is also known as a unity gain amplifier, a voltage buffer, or an isolation amplifier. In a voltage follower circuit, the output voltage is equal to the input voltage; thus, it has a gain of one (unity) and does not amplify the incoming signal.

What is instrumentation amplifier?

Instrumentation amplifier. An instrumentation (or instrumentational) amplifier is a type of differential amplifier that has been outfitted with input buffers, which eliminate the need for input impedance matching and thus make the amplifier particularly suitable for use in measurement and test equipment.
